The Need for a Real Patriot Act
By Bogdan Dzakovic, NSWBC Member
It should be readily apparent by now that the 9-11 terrorist
attacks could have been prevented but for the failure of our government to do
its job. Contrary to the 9-11 Commission’s
main conclusion, the failures of our government were NOT due to “a failure of
imagination”. Whistleblowers from
EVERY engaged agency responsible for defending this country have reported their
own attempts to prevent 9-11 and were thwarted by their own bureaucracies. These bureaucratic failures were not caused
by a lack of resources or legislative authority as implied by the provisions of
the current Patriot Act. Instead, these
failures have been documented to have been caused by bureaucratic turf battles
and inertia, gross mismanagement, and topped off by a lack of appropriate
Congressional oversight.

Hence, we now have the emersion of a new breed of American
Patriots. People who took an oath to
defend this country and the Constitution of the United States from all enemies,
both foreign and DOMESTIC. People who
did their jobs effectively and according to their sacred trust as civil and/or
military servants, but were thwarted by an iron curtain of bureaucratic
sludge. People who took the dangerous
step of aggressively fulfilling their jobs by taking their concerns outside the
normal channels where these problems are unceremoniously buried. In every single one of these cases, the
individuals suffered reprisal from the very same broken bureaucracy that they
attempted to fix. Some lost their jobs,
others have been relegated to doing idiot work for the rest of their careers. Some of the current batch of these patriots have
even had their lives threatened.

It is time for the Congress to institute a new and real
Patriot Act which protects these individuals. I fully support Senator
Lautenberg’s bill [the Whistleblower Empowerment, Security and Taxpayer
Protection Act of 2006], as a first step in bringing some honor back into
public service. And for those
